  Combined with factors such as the number of years of car obsolescence and the life of power batteries, from 2018 to 2020, the country's cumulative scrapped power batteries will reach 120,000 to 200,000 tons; by 2025, the annual scrap volume of power batteries may reach 350,000 tons.

  Battery processing technology and supervision still need to be improved

  At the two sessions this year, Li Wenhai, member of the National Committee of the Chinese People’s Political Consultative Conference and deputy director of the Standing Committee of Tianjin Jinnan District People’s Congress, pointed out that my country’s new energy vehicle battery recycling is facing three major problems: the small scale of the scrap battery recycling market, the low level of technology, and the delayed disposal of scrap batteries. . In this regard, Li Wenhai put forward three suggestions, suggesting scientific treatment of rare resources, realization of cascade recycling, turning waste into treasure, strengthening the management of the scrap battery recycling market, and introducing preferential policies to support the recycling of scrap batteries for new energy vehicles.

  Similarly, Cui Dongshu, secretary-general of the National Passenger Vehicle Market Information Joint Council, also believes that at present, enterprises are not mature enough to evaluate the residual value of retired power batteries, health status evaluation and other key technologies, and the research and development of related technologies for cascade utilization and recycling is relatively lagging. Industry experts are required to collaborate to promote technological innovation and application, and break through technical difficulties.

  "Different models have different battery designs, with differences in internal and external structural design, module connection methods, integration forms, etc. The same set of disassembly lines cannot be used to fit all battery packs and internal modules, resulting in extremely inconvenient battery disassembly. Therefore, most processes are completed manually, but the skill level of the workers may affect the yield in the battery recycling process. Therefore, what measures and methods are adopted to ensure the safety of the battery disassembly process is also very important. "Cui Dongshu introduced to reporters.
